The story unfolds around the turbulent events in the romance between an army lieutenant, Ijuuin Shinobu, and a lively schoolgirl, Hanamura Benio. Minami plays Ijuuin\u2019s army subordinate, Sergeant Onijima Shinko. \u201cI want to express Onijima\u2019s manly spirit and his compassionate nature,\u201d she says about her character. While she also played Onijima in the previous performance, three years earlier, when she read the script over again \u201cI found my way of approaching roles had changed,\u201d she says. \u201cI want to give a deeper level of performance this time around.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>While the performance was originally scheduled to open in May, due to the effects of the coronavirus the opening day was delayed by five months. During the social distancing period, \u201cin order to keep my performance quality from dropping, I never skipped training at home, and kept waiting for the reopening.\u201d Even though she couldn\u2019t go outside for a long period, she revealed some of the ways she came up with to entertain herself at home: \u201cI would take plenty of time preparing my own food so that it would look as if I\u2019d gone out to eat and \u2018play restaurant.\u2019\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cPeople who have been hurt can move forward by finding comrades. That\u2019s one of the appeals this show has for me.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Minami is an otokoyaku in her twelfth year since joining Takarazuka. Besides singing and acting, she is known for her sharp dance skills, and is an invaluable addition to performances. \u201cI want to be sincere as an actor,\u201d she says. She says this philosophy is because \u201cwhen you\u2019re onstage, your true self will start to seep in,\u201d and she also keeps the motto of Takarasiennes, \u201cPure, Proper, and Beautiful\u201d in her heart. She goes onstage every day believing \u201cwith every performance, I want to improve in some aspect.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Three questions: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>What is the one thing you would bring to a deserted island?<br><\/em>I\u2019d be lonely by myself, so I\u2019d bring a companion.
